This is not a name that I am connected with or researching; I just saw the query and thought I might be able to help. First of all you are not likely to find a birth certificate. They didn't exist in that period. The province did make an attempt to record births between 1864 and 1877 although it was by no mean 100%. In a few places the practice was continued after 1877 but it was not legislated until the early 1900's. Early Nova Scotia Vital Stats can be accessed at
www.novascotiagenealogy.ca
This is a free, searchable site and by downloading a free viewer program available onsite, you can see the actual record. I found both the marriage record and Death Certificate of Suther Currie; also marriage records of Eliza Ann Archibald to Michael Howlan in 1869 and Eliza Ann Howland to Peter Curry in 1872.
